Project Highlight Located at Lancaster Airport Authority, Transteck, Inc., a commercial truck dealership, began their multiyear development plan to build several new hangars, one of which will house Transteck’s Aviation Department. Engaged by Morgan-Keller Construction for this new 15,426 square foot pre-engineered steel building, Triad’s Materials Testing & Inspection team provided storm water basin and building pad soils testing; concrete testing for footings, slabs and exterior concrete; masonry foundation walls testing; structural steel inspections; and asphalt compaction testing. Onsite discovery of large deep pockets of topsoil that needed to be removed and replaced with suitable fil, old foundations from the previous hangar, and an underground cistern draining into an onsite concrete well casing situated over a sinkhole cavity into the native bedrock. All issues were able to be remediated via recommendations from Triad. As a multi-disciplinary consulting firm, Triad Engineering, Inc. (Triad) provides geotechnical and civil engineering, landscape architecture, environmental services, land surveying, construction materials testing and monitoring, drilling, and construction materials laboratory services, to a wide range of clients. Established in 1975, we pride ourselves in being an employee-owned firm with nearly 200 employees throughout West Virginia, Virginia, Maryland, Pennsylvania and Ohio. Our professional staff can take a development project from property acquisition through construction. This ability offers our expertise to clients during all phases of a project which ultimately leads to greater project success. Prompt service, open communication, and high quality work are our goals for every project. ESOP Triad Engineering, Inc. is 100% employee owned and operated. Our Employee Stock Ownership Plan serves as a retirement plan for employees by holding tax-free investments on their behalf until retirement age. Triad pays all of the contributions to this plan out of company profits, and no taxes are due until shares are distributed.

Drivers, take note! Our state's highway workers are hard at work maintaining thousands of miles of roads. Let's give them the respect they deserve by slowing down and paying close attention to construction signs. The "Give 'Em A Brake" program is in full swing to protect our workers on the job. This summer, you'll see extra signs urging you to slow down and give them a "brake" in work zones. Remember, it's not just about protecting them—it's about protecting yourself too. The majority of injuries and fatalities in work zones involve drivers and passengers. So, for everyone's safety, please drive carefully, be alert, and obey the posted speed limits.
